    摘要:

    飞行时间质谱技术(TOF—MS)作为质谱技术的一种,因具有高灵敏度及高分辨率等优点,已作为高端检测手段在食品质量安全领域广泛应用。文章综述飞行时间质谱技术的发展现状,及其在食品添加剂、食品污染物、违法添加的非食用物质、农药残留、兽药残留及真菌毒素6个方面应用的国内外研究进展,并展望该技术的应用前景。

    Abstract:

    The food contaminants and residues from food processing and food packaging materials are threating the food quality and safety, such as pesticide residue, veterinary drug, illegal non-food substances and organic pollutants. Therefore, the advanced modern detection methods are indispensable for food analysis. Meanwhile, the complex of food matrix and diversity of the food contaminants and residues also propose the higher requirements for food detection technology. The time of flight mass as one of the mass techniques is considered as a superior analysis technique and has been applied in food quality and safety analysis as a result of its high sensitivity and resolution. In this paper, research progresses of the time of flight mass on the detection of food additives, food contaminants and residues, illegal non-food substances, pesticide residue, veterinary drug and mycotoxin have been reviewed and its probable approaching applications have been prospected.
